Mold damage removal typically involves identifying the extent of the infestation and the affected materials. The licensed pros will then establish containment barriers to prevent spore dispersal throughout your Tulsa home. This often includes removing and safely disposing of contaminated porous materials like drywall or insulation and cleaning non-porous surfaces with specialized antimicrobial solutions. The process concludes with thorough drying and air purification to ensure a healthy indoor environment.
A mold evaluation involves a visual inspection of your property, identifying areas with visible mold growth or potential moisture issues. Specialists will also inquire about any musty odors or reported health symptoms. They may conduct air and surface sampling to quantify spore counts and identify specific mold types, then analyze these findings to determine the scope of the problem and recommend appropriate remediation strategies for your Tulsa residence.
Mold mitigation services focus on preventing further mold growth and controlling moisture sources. This includes identifying and repairing leaks, improving ventilation, and reducing indoor humidity levels. The licensed pros will also implement containment strategies during remediation to prevent the spread of spores to unaffected areas of your home. Effective mitigation aims to create an environment where mold cannot thrive, ensuring long-term protection.
Mold mitigation companies distinguish themselves by prioritizing the prevention of mold growth and addressing the underlying causes of moisture. While remediation removes existing mold, mitigation focuses on long-term solutions like sealing leaks, improving airflow, and implementing strategies to keep humidity low.
